I will move on to two other issues. One is hospitals coming back to providing services. I recently spoke to someone who is working in a hospital operating theatre. In the past two weeks they had a full complement of theatre staff and they had to do a particular operation because it was urgent, but they were not able to do their elective list which they normally did on a particular day in the week. They had a full complement of theatre staff and of staff in the wards and there were empty beds on the wards. What is being done now to get all of the hospitals back up and running and doing elective surgeries given the significant backlog of elective surgeries in every area, including orthopaedic and paediatric surgery? What is being done in that area to get every hospital up and running in respect of those services?
